Condensing steam at 150oC is used on the inside of a bank of tubes to heat a cross-flow stream of CO2 that enters at 3 atm, 35oC, and 5 m/s. The tube bank consists of 100 tubes of 1.25-cm OD in a square in-line array with Sn = Sp =1.875 cm. The tubes are 60 cm long. Assuming the outside-tube-wall temperature is constant at 150oC, calculate the overall heat transfer to the CO2 and its exit temperature.
